										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>A remarkable <strong>ichthyosaur fossil</strong> discovered in Germany reveals how this ancient marine predator survived against the odds, even after suffering severe jaw injuries. Dating back approximately <strong>180 million years</strong>, the specimen belongs to the Temnodontosaurus genus, a group of marine reptiles that ruled the Jurassic seas.</p>
<p>This fossil was unearthed in the Mistelgau clay pit, a site renowned for its well-preserved marine fossils. Researchers found fragments of the skull, lower jaw, shoulder girdle, forefins, spine, and over <strong>100 teeth</strong>. This level of preservation offers invaluable insights into Jurassic sea life.</p>
<p>The ichthyosaur could grow over <strong>20 feet (around 6.5 metres)</strong> long and bears a striking resemblance to modern dolphins. But what’s truly fascinating is the evidence of its injuries. The specimen shows signs of severe jaw trauma—suggesting that it lived with these challenges for an extended period.</p>
<p>Researchers in Germany stated that this well-preserved specimen highlights not just the physical adaptations of ichthyosaurs but also their resilience in the face of adversity. The findings imply that these ancient marine predators might have survived longer than previously believed.</p>

										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The recent discovery of a <strong>180-million-year-old ichthyosaur</strong> fossil in Mistelgau, Germany, is turning heads in the paleontological community. This specimen, belonging to the genus Temnodontosaurus, measures an impressive 21 feet in length. But what truly stands out are the severe injuries it sustained during its life—injuries that challenge our understanding of prehistoric survival and feeding adaptations.</p>
<p>Since excavations began at the Mistelgau site in 1998, it has yielded numerous marine fossils. However, this find is particularly significant due to its nearly complete skull, lower jaw, shoulder girdle, spine, and over 100 teeth. It paints a vivid picture of the ecological dynamics that existed in Jurassic seas.</p>
<p>Interestingly, the fossil shows signs of severe jaw injuries. According to Stefan Eggmaier, one of the researchers involved, &#8220;The injuries likely significantly limited the animal&#8217;s ability to catch prey.&#8221; This raises questions about how this ichthyosaur managed to survive despite such debilitating conditions.</p>
<p>Moreover, the presence of gastroliths—stones found in the abdominal cavity—suggests a possible shift in feeding behavior. This adaptation may have been crucial for its survival in a competitive marine ecosystem. As Eggmaier noted, &#8220;The fact that it nevertheless survived is evidenced&#8230; by its heavily worn teeth and gastroliths.&#8221; Such findings highlight the complexities of convergent evolution among marine reptiles.</p>
<p>This ichthyosaur is one of the youngest finds within its genus to date. Ulrike Albert from the research team stated that this discovery challenges previous assumptions regarding the survival timeline of ichthyosaurs in this region. Observers are left pondering how these ancient creatures navigated their environments amid such adversity.</p>
